import java.util.*;
public class Main{
    public static void main(String[] args){

    Scanner sc=new Scanner(System.in);  
    String str=sc.nextLine();
    String[] arr=str.split(";");
    for(int z=0;z<arr.length;z++){
        if(arr[z].equals("")){
            arr[z]="0";
        }
    }
      int num=0;int x=0;int y=0;
      int numA=0;int numD=0;int numW=0;int numS=0;
    for(int i=0;i<arr.length;i++){
        if(arr[i].charAt(0)=='A'){
            for(int j=1;j<arr[i].length();j++){
                if(arr[i].charAt(j)<='9'&&arr[i].charAt(j)>='0'){
                    num=num+1;
                }else{num=0;break;}
                if(num==arr[i].length()-1) {
                   numA=Integer.parseInt((String)arr[i].subSequence(1, arr[i].length()));num=0;
                   x=x-numA;
                }
            }
       }else if(arr[i].charAt(0)=='D'){
           for(int j=1;j<arr[i].length();j++){
               if(arr[i].charAt(j)<='9'&&arr[i].charAt(j)>='0'){
                   num=num+1;
               }else{num=0;break;}
               if(num==arr[i].length()-1) {
                     numD=Integer.parseInt((String)arr[i].subSequence(1, arr[i].length()));num=0;
                  x=x+numD;
               }
           }
      }else if(arr[i].charAt(0)=='W'){
          for(int j=1;j<arr[i].length();j++){
              if(arr[i].charAt(j)<='9'&&arr[i].charAt(j)>='0'){
                  num=num+1;
              }else{num=0;break;}
              if(num==arr[i].length()-1) {
                   numW=Integer.parseInt((String)arr[i].subSequence(1, arr[i].length()));num=0;
                 y=y+numW;
              }
          }
     }else if(arr[i].charAt(0)=='S'){
         for(int j=1;j<arr[i].length();j++){
             if(arr[i].charAt(j)<='9'&&arr[i].charAt(j)>='0'){
                 num=num+1;
             }else{num=0;break;}
             if(num==arr[i].length()-1) {
                 numS=Integer.parseInt((String)arr[i].subSequence(1, arr[i].length()));num=0;
                y=y-numS;
             }
         }
    }
    }System.out.println(x+","+y);
   }
}
